HORIZONTAL DRAINS AS EFFECTIVE MEASURE FOR LANDSLIDE REMEDIATION
Abstract Decrease of groundwater table level or decrease of buoyancy effects of groundwater is one of the most important landslide remediation measures. In Slovakia as well as in the world the horizontal drainage boreholes are often used for the landslide remediation. The article describes 40 years’ experience with use of the horizontal drainage boreholes in Slovakia, particularly in terms of their effectiveness and long-term functionality.
